What To Do When You Lose Natural Teeth
As adolescents, we lose our primary teeth as a natural part of growing up. However, in adulthood, losing teeth is caused by oral health issues. Gum disease is the number one cause. Since missing teeth at adulthood isn’t natural, this means problems. You could have problems with nutritional intake. Problems articulating are a common consequence. For minor cases, a dental bridge could be the best option, restoring smile function. For several gaps, partial dentures could offer a solution and address complicated tooth loss. Finally, a complete set of dentures could be custom-made. While most complete dentures and partial dentures are removable, they could be secured with dental implants. Dental implants act as natural teeth, and prevent negative changes to your alveolar bone and facial structure following losing a tooth.
